Tyrese Trolls Kanye West Over Rapper's NSFW Posts of Wife Bianca Censori

The 'Fast and Furious' actor makes use of his Instagram account to make fun of the 'Famous' rapper over his raunchy posts featuring his wife that lands him in hot water.

AceShowbiz - Tyrese Gibson poked fun at Kanye West after the latter made headlines for his raunchy posts featuring his wife Bianca Censori. Making use of his Instagram account, the "Fast and Furious" actor shared a hilarious response to the posts.

On Saturday, January 20, Tyrese shared a video of him hanging out on a beach with his current girlfriend, Zelie Timothy. The clip saw his beau rocking a nude-colored bikini as she seductively invited him to join him in the water.

"Dear Kanye...All wheat, hold the cream," so Tyrese wrote over the video. In the caption, meanwhile, the "F9" star penned, "All love………. Just loving on my carmel chocolate @zelietimothy #AllLove."

Ty was referring to one of Ye's cpntroversial posts which he captioned with, "Cream of Wheat." In the post, Ye's wife Bianca could be seen putting her derriere on full display as she donned a skimpy bikini as she was standing next to a box of Cream of Wheat cereal.

She additionally showcased a huge amount of side-boob while completing her racy outfit with a black leather mask and boots. Another snap featured the Yeezy architectural designer covering herself in a long black leather coat with the same mask only to reveal more skin in another picture.

The nearly-naked pictures unsurprisingly landed Ye in hot water. Fans pointed out that Ye used to slam his ex-wife Kim Kardashian for her sexy outfits. "I remember the episode where he was telling Kim he didn't want her to expose herself so much. FFWD to this. Poor girl being degraded on the daily. I hope she believes in herself to realize she is much more than this," one of them wrote.

Someone else criticized the "Vultures" rapper for posting the risque pictures after declaring to be a devout Christian over the last couple of years. "how do you release a gospel album and claim you're following the path of the Lord, then do some s**t like this," one person asked. Some others, on the other hand, accused Ye of exploiting Bianca with one commenting, "Why do you exploit this poor woman? Shame on you. You need therapy sir."
